Organized in 1899, VF Corporation is a global leader in branded lifestyle apparel, footwear and accessories with nearly 70,000 associates and $12.4 billion in revenue. In August 2018, VF announced its plans to spin off the Jeanswear business comprised of approximately 20,000 employees and $2.5 billion in revenue. The new company, Kontoor Brands, Inc., will be a separate publicly-traded company headquartered in Greensboro, NC and includes the Wrangler, Lee, and VF Outlet brands.
The spin is planned to be effective in the first half of 2019 and will position Kontoor Brands as the home of iconic brands steeped in heritage and authenticity.
